Agriculture is an important part of the Greene County economy. The Agritourism Trail features more than 35 farms offering llama and goat farms, greenhouses, apple orchards, corn mazes, stops on the Quilt Trail and much more. Appalachian National Scenic Trail
Harpers Ferry, WV 25425
A hiking trail running 2,155 miles from Maine to Georgia with 156.36 miles in Tennessee and North Carolina.

Follow the Quilt Trail
TN
The Quilt Trail winds through Northeast Tennessee and features traditional quilt patterns displayed in color on a number of beautiful historic barns. A variety of historic sites, produce stands, shops, galleries and other places provide shopping places along the way.

Hardin Park
456 E. Bernard Ave (Directors Office)
Greeneville, TN 37743
423-638-3143
This is a 60 acre park that is the focal point of the Greeneville Parks & Recreation Facilities. It contains the following: 6 pavilions, 5 tennis courts, 2 basketball courts, 5 ball fields, 2 playgrounds, 1 Olympic size pool and park maintenance building.
